Job Description and Position Requirements

The Survey Research Center at Pennsylvania State University is seeking self‑motivated, reliable part‑time Field Interviewers to collect bio‑samples and administer surveys to parents and children in their homes. Primary locations include Harrisburg, Hershey, and surrounding areas; home visits will also occur in Delaware, Maryland, Texas, Florida, and other states as needed. Applicants must be phlebotomists, available to work 5–35 hours per week, including evenings and weekends. Successful candidates will gain valuable experience in social science data collection and survey administration. Excellent people skills, attention to detail, flexibility, and reliable transportation are required.

Responsibilities
  • Follow a specific protocol for sample collection and survey administration.
  • Attend mandatory training sessions.
  • Use basic computer and internet technology for data entry and reporting.
  • Establish and maintain a good rapport with study respondents.
  • Remain organized and detail‑oriented.
  • Keep detailed records of all work activities.
Qualifications and Verifications

Must have Phlebotomist Certification.
